On Wed, 26 Sep 2001, Luis Pablo Gasparotto wrote:
> But after doing:
> bash-2.04# ecasound -i /Luispa3/track01.cdda.wav -o alsa,default -d:255
[...]
> ALSA lib dlmisc.c:54:(snd_dlsym_verify) unable to verify version for symbol snd_config_hook_load
> ALSA lib conf.c:2192:(snd_config_update) hooks failed, removing configuration
[...]
> ERROR: [ECA-CHAINSETUP] : "Enabling chainsetup: AUDIOIO-ALSA3: Unable to open ALSA-device for playback; error: No such file or directory"
Ok, this is a known issue with 2.0.2 and the very latest ALSA
versions. There was a thread about it here on ecasound-list:
http://www.wakkanet.fi/~kaiv/ecasound/ecasound-list/2001/09/0012.html
Basicly there was a change in ALSA relating to dynamic loading of
ALSA-support, which broke ecasound 2.0.2's ALSA-support. Either
recompile ecasound with the patch (see the above thread),
use the CVS-version or wait for 2.0.3...
